Actor John Leguizamo compares Latino support for Trump to ‘roaches for Raid’

Actor John Leguizamo ripped Latinos who support President Trump on Friday, saying that “Latin people for Republicans are like roaches for Raid.”

“I just feel like there’s a level of self-hate, or just lack of care for the rest of your Latin brothers and sisters who are in cages, who are being demonized by this president,” Leguizamo, 56, said in an appearance on “Real Time with Bill Maher.”

Maher had asked the Colombia-born, New York-raised entertainer about news reporting that Trump has made some inroads with young Latino men.

Leguizamo, who showed up on the show via video wearing a tie and a Mets hat, said Latino support for Trump is “self-hating and selfish.”

“Twenty-three people were shot in El Paso for just being Latin,” he said, referencing the mass shooting in Texas last year. “And you don’t care so you’re going to vote for this braggadocio president?”

Overall, Biden has a wide lead on Trump with Latinos, according to polling. Almost two-thirds of Latino voters said they would vote for Biden or were leaning that way, according to Pew data published this week.
